Definition

Dismount means to get down from a mounted position, especially from a horse or similar animal.

Sample Sentences

  1. She decided to dismount her horse before entering the crowded festival.
  2. The knight gracefully dismounted from his steed, ready to face his opponent.
  3. After the long ride, he took a moment to dismount and stretch his legs.
